Dual Frequency

The dual-frequency HDI Skimmer 50/200 includes a single ceramic element delivering both 50 kHz with a 29° beam width, and 200 kHz with a 12° beam width. 50 kHz low-frequency operation offers a maximum operational depth of 900 m (3000 ft), while 200 kHz high-frequency provides higher-resolution fish arches and bottom detail in shallower water.

 

DownScan Imaging™

High-frequency 455/800 kHz DownScan Imaging provides a life-like representation of the water column, bottom, and any structure beneath your vessel: see fish, rocks, weeds, and wrecks clearly pictured your multifunction display. DownScan is a powerful tool for locating fish-holding structure, finding wrecks or reefs to dive, or conducting searches and surveys.

 

Depth/Temperature

One sensor does it all. Able to measure both depth and temperature in a single package, the HDI Skimmer 50/200 simplifies installation and requires just one connection to your echosounder module or multifunction display.

 

Mounting

The HDI Skimmer 50/200 is suitable for transom mounting on any hull. Transom-mounted transducers are designed for smaller outboard and I/O boats, and are well suited to planing hulls. Transom mounting offers simple installation and maintenance, and the transducer can be adjusted easily to compensate for transom angle.
